Output 39f2b98dd05169cfc74c11fa35ff24e6a5ad3626650718f0e40584275196f6b7:3

value
669165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e171b6de15e17212ad45dc9d0dbca1a34256c74 OP_EQUAL
address
37MKVx3YRWrPLsQ3b9WkirQR9MaQDv1b8T
transaction
39f2b98dd05169cfc74c11fa35ff24e6a5ad3626650718f0e40584275196f6b7
spent
true